您的位置: 嵌入式在线 > 伯乐桥 > 技能培训 > Windows CE.Net BSP高级研修班(TSBSP0601)

Windows CE.Net BSP高级研修班(TSBSP0601)

2006-12-10      嵌入式在线      收藏 | 打印
 课程目标

        BSP的定制与移植是进行Windows CE开发的前提和难点问题,为了帮助学员在最短的时间内掌握BSP的开发技术,本课程创新性的将案例教学模式引入培训过程中,精心选取BSP研发中最常见的最小系统BSP定制等四个工程实际问题(详见课程进度安排)作为案例,详细讲述BSP的开发、调试等方法。将理论、开发方法的讲解贯穿于案例的分析过程中,使得学员通过学习不仅可以马上解决工程中常见的问题,而且可以举一反三,具备自行解决问题的能力。

   培养对象

        从事Windows CE.NET系统移植和开发的研发人员。

   入学要求

        学员学习本课程应具备下列基础知识:
        ◆ 有C语言编程基础;
        ◆ 有ARM处理器开发基础。

   师资团队

       【陈曦】

●     长期从事Windows CE嵌入式操作系统的开发与科研工作,熟悉ARM嵌入式系统的软硬件开发流程和方法,有3年的培训经验,讲课经验丰富,思维敏捷,通俗易懂,深受学员喜爱。

更多师资力量请参见华清远见师资团队。

   教材

        ◆ 《Windows CE.Net BSP课程讲义》

   学时

        课时: 2天(12学时)
       最新开班时间(名额有限,请提前在线或电话预约)
       07年01月03日-07年01月04日

每期班名额有限,报满即停止报名,请提前在线或电话预约

   费用

        ◆培训费用(含教材费和午餐费):1500元,团体报名优惠措施:两人95折优惠,三人或三人以上9折优惠
        ◆上课地点:清华大学

   课程进度安排
时间 课程大纲

第一天

9:00
|
12:00

预备知识:Windows CE.Net BSP源代码情景分析
      0.1 BSP的目录结构
      0.2 BSP源代码配置文件介绍(DIRS、SOURCES文件)
      0.3 BSP镜像配置文件介绍(BIB,REG,DAT,DB和STR文件)
      实验0.1:建立BSP编译环境
      0.4 Windows CE.Net内核镜像生成过程分析
      实验0.2:添加文件到操作系统映像

13:30
|
16:30

案例1 Bootloader的定制
      1.1 引导程序分析
      实验1.1 定制启动界面
      1.2 EBOOT的控制流图及相关函数分析
      实验1.2 修改以太网调试函数
      1.3 HAL层源程序分析
      实验1.3 利用以太网实现KITL传输

第二天

9:00
|
12:00

案例2 最小系统的BSP定制
      2.1 时间片调整
      实验2.1 时间片调整实验
      2.2 Windows CE的内存管理
      实验2.2 物理内存到虚拟内存的映射实验
      2.2 存储器SDRAM, NAND Flash,Nor Flash的定制
      实验2.3 从NAND Flash或Nor Flash中启动Windows CE
案例3 串口本机驱动程序
      3.1 本机驱动程序的结构
      3.2 串口本机驱动程序实例分析

13:30
|
16:30

案例4 中断处理
      4.1 Windows CE中断模型
      4.2 BSP中有关中断的源程序详解
      实验4 观察串口中断程序的处理过程

本文来源:华清远见    作者:
热点资讯(一周点击率)
热评博文
评一评已有 0 位网友对此文发表了看法。  我也来评一下

验证码:  看不清?换一张

 

快乐大本营
工程师之星
高福东
擅长嵌入式开发及单片机应用开发
  • 王波涛  熟悉单片机及其接口技术
  • 朱伟平  熟悉51单片机系统LCD驱动程序编写及调试。
热门招聘
论坛热贴